What is the role of an FTO?
A field training officer (FTO) is an experienced or senior member of an organization who is responsible for the training and evaluation of a junior or probationary level member. The role is used extensively in law enforcement, fire departments, and emergency medical services.
What is FTP in PNP?
The PNP Field Training Program (FTP) is a program designed to expose trainees and new recruits to the police community and actual police work, according to PNP Chief Gen.
What is the meaning of field training?
Field training means instruction, training, or skill practice rendered to an officer by another officer or officers on a tutorial basis during a tour of duty while performing the normal activities of that officer’s employment.
How long is the FTO program for LAPD?
The training cycle consists of 16-20 weeks of intensive on-the-job training and daily performance evaluations. Training is conducted and staffed by field training officers (FTOs) and FTO Sergeants.

What is beat patrol in PNP?
Beat Patrol Duties – a “walk and observe” duties that protect pedestrians, workers, houses, streets, offices, etc., from being molested and burglarized by criminals. It is also the avenue where communicating with people takes place and forges friendly relations with the members of the community.
How many months is FTP in PNP?
12 months
Field Training Program (FTP) – a program that involves actual experience and assignment in patrol, traffic, and investigation works by all members of the PNP as a requirement for the permanency of their appointment. The program shall be for 12 months inclusive of the Basic Recruit Course for Police Officer 1.
What is field training in psychology?
In this course students are placed in a supervised field experience in a selected agency or institution along with a classroom component. The course emphasizes application of psychological concepts and research in an applied setting.
